What are Hostels?
They offer dormitory-style rooms with separate quarters for men and women. Some also have private family and couples rooms. All hostels provide a blanket and pillow. Linens are often included in the price, or available for rental.

Most offer fully equipped self-service kitchens or cafeterias, dining areas, secure storage and common rooms for relaxing and socializing with other travellers. Some have laundry facilities, travel libraries and concierge service.

There are a few that even have hot tubs, swimming pools, barbecues and an ocean at its front door. Most have secure 24-hour access and are handicapped accessible.

Why stay in one?
Most offer a cheap, clean, safe place to stay and the communal atmosphere makes it easy to make friends and pick up insider travel tips. For those journeying solo, they offer the best way to meet fellow travellers and even find travel companions.

What facilities are available?
Ranging from a bunk bed to a cot, some have rooms with 2 to 10 beds, while others offer orphanage-like dormitories that pack in 20 or more. Sleeping arrangements are usually single-sex, though co-ed rooms are sometimes available.

Many also offer private "family rooms" for couples or groups. Sheets, a sleep-sheet (two sheets sewn together like a sleeping bag), pillows and blankets may be available (usually for a small fee). As this differs from place to place, it's smart to travel with a sleeping bag, sleep-sheet, sarong (which becomes a convenient sheet) or combination of all three.

How much do they cost?
Though the cost varies from country to country, they always offer the best value for your money, especially if you're travelling by yourself. In general, the prices range from £4.00 - £18.00 per night for dormitory accommodations.
